自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 收藏
  • 关注

转载 求字符中的数字、字母、汉字

各种字符的unicode编码的范围:汉字:[0x4e00,0x9fa5] 或 十进制[19968,40869]数字:[0x30,0x39] 或 十进制[48, 57]小写字母:[0x61,0x7a] 或 十进制[97, 122]大写字母:[0x41,0x5a] 或 十进制[65, 90]//取出一串字符串中的英文字母,不区分大小写public class test { public static void main(String[] args) { String s

2020-05-11 18:16:29 229

原创 SpringBoot中使用ehcache

1.引入依赖<!--ehcache依赖--><dependency> <groupId>net.sf.ehcache</groupId> <artifactId>ehcache</artifactId></dependency><dependency> <group...

2020-05-06 19:59:24 615

转载 SpringBoot加载全局配置文件的顺序

SpringBoot启动会扫描以下位置的application.properties或者application.ymls文件作为SpringBoot的默认配置文件file:/config/file:/classpath:/config/classpath:/ (全局配置文件默认放在类路径根目录下)以上是按照优先级由高到低的顺序。所有的配置文件都会被加载,互补配置。高优先级的配置...

2019-07-14 14:21:57 522

转载 多环境(开发、测试、生产)配置文件的切换

Profile是Spring对不同环境提供不同配置功能的支持,可以通过激活指定参数等方式快速切换环境1、多Profile文件形式,通过激活指定配置文件来完成配置文件的切换profile文件命名格式:application-{profile}.propertieseg:application-develop.properties 、application-test.properties、app...

2019-07-13 21:30:45 1110

转载 SpringBoot中常用注解

1 @PropertySource—加载指定路径的配置文件@PropertySource只支持properties 文件 不支持 yaml文件。@PropertySource使用并不影响@ConfigurationProperties@Component@ConfigurationProperties(prefix = "person")@PropertySource(value = "...

2019-07-11 20:23:54 109

转载 properties/yml配置文件中的属性值获取

一 通过@ConfigurationProperties获取值1.创建Bean@ConfigurationProperties----告诉SpringBoot将本类中的属性与配置文件中相关配置(prefix=“xxx”)进行绑定@Component@ConfigurationProperties(prefix = "person")public class Person { pr...

2019-07-11 16:13:20 4331

转载 yaml基本语法

一 基本格式 1,YAML大小写敏感; 2,使用缩进代表层级关系; 3,缩进只能使用空格,不能使用TAB,不要求空格个数,只需要相同层级左对齐(一般2个或4个空格)二 写法 ①字面量: 普通值(字符串(单双引号有区别),数字,布尔) name: "lida \n" 输出 name: lida 换行 ---------双引号中特殊字符可作...

2019-07-07 17:35:31 371

转载 Linux中ActiveMQ的安装

一 前提 1.activemq是java语言开发的,需要jdk 2.上传activemq压缩包并解压二 进入bin,启动服务 启动: ./activemq start 关闭 ./activemq stop 查看状态:./activemq status三 进入管理后台...

2019-05-01 18:17:58 101

转载 微信小程序笔记

一1.根目录下用app来命名的这四中类型的文件,就是程序入口文件。app.js、app.json、app.wxss ,app.wxml 小程序的主页面是靠在JSON文件中配置来决定的app.json是当前小程序的全局配置,包括了小程序的所有页面路径、界面表现、网络超时时间、底部 tab 等2.app.js文件管理整个程序的生命周期,可以在这个文件中监听并处理小程序的生命周...

2019-04-24 17:51:17 121

原创 值传递与引用传递

一 形参与实参 参数在程序语言中分为形式参数和实际参数。 形参:是在定义函数参数列表时使用的参数,目的是用来接收调用该函数时传入的参数。 实参:在调用有参函数时,主调函数和被调函数之间有数据传递关系。在主调函数中调用一个函数时,其参数列表中的参数称为“实际参数”。 xxxObject.xxxMethod("实参");...

2019-04-13 13:18:48 96

原创 Linux中搭建solr服务

前提:Linux安装好jdk、tomcat一 把solr 的压缩包上传到Linux系统并解压二 把solr部署到Tomcat下。启动Tomcat解压缩solr的war包 1.先创建文件夹solr,用来搭建solr服务 2.拷贝tomcat到/usr/local/solr,并把solr.war包拷贝到tomcat/webapps/...

2019-04-08 22:27:03 220

转载 Redis集群的搭建

一 Redis集群 1. 什么是redis集群:https://blog.csdn.net/codejas/article/details/79854953 2.为什么要使用redis集群:https://blog.csdn.net/heatdeath/article/details/79450461 3.redis集群的设计原理:https:...

2019-04-08 11:35:48 96

翻译 Redis

一 NoSQL 为了解决高并发、高可扩展(集群)、高可用(不能宕机)、大数据存储问题而产生的数据库解决方案,就是NoSql数据库。NoSql :全称 not only sql ,非关系型数据库。可以作为关系型数据库的一个很好的补充。不能替代。 NoSQL分类:键值(Key-Value)存储数据库 相关产品: Tokyo Cabinet/Tyran...

2019-04-07 22:50:47 96

翻译 Dubbo

一 Dubbo DUBBO是一个分布式服务框架,致力于提供高性能和透明化的RPC远程服务调用方案,是阿里巴巴SOA服务化治理方案的核心框架。 随着互联网的发展,网站应用的规模不断扩大,常规的垂直应用架构已无法应对,分布式服务架构以及流动计算架构势在必行,亟需一个治理系统确保架构有条不紊的演进。 单一应用架构 当网站流量很小时...

2019-04-07 16:20:03 96

翻译 通过nginx访问ftp服务器中的图片

前提:Linux中已经安装好了nginx和ftp服务器vsftpd一 为用户设置权限 cd /usr/local/nginx/conf二 修改服务器的默认网站根目录位置三 重启nginx四 关闭防火墙 chkconfig iptables off测试:浏览器中输入 IP地址/images/图片...

2019-04-05 16:06:06 1964 2

翻译 Linux中安装vsftpd

一 安装vsftpd组件yum -y install vsftpd二 添加一个ftp用户useradd ftpuser这样一个用户建完,可以用这个登录,记得用普通登录不要用匿名了。登录后默认的路径为 /home/ftpuser三 给ftp用户添加密码 passwd ftpuser(ftpuser)四 防火墙开启21端口 因为ftp默认的端口为21,而centos默认是没有...

2019-04-05 13:32:44 2995

翻译 Linux中nginx的安装和启动

安装环境: ①gcc:安装nginx需要先将官网下载的源码进行编译,编译依赖gcc环境,如果没有gcc环境,需要安装gcc: yum install gcc-c++ ②PCRE:PCRE(Perl Compatible Regular Expressions)是一个Perl...

2019-04-04 22:32:09 125

翻译 MVC思想

一 思想 Servlet作为前端控制器,负责接收客户端发送的请求。 在Servlet中只包含控制逻辑和简单的前端处理;然后,调用后端JavaBean来完成实际的逻辑处理; 最后,将其转发到相应的JSP页面来处理显示。二 流程图...

2019-04-04 12:58:34 140

原创 Java基础--面向对象

1、对象:对象是一种对于事物的概念,有其对应的属性(事物的特性)和方法(事物行为)。对同类对象抽象出其共性,形成类。类是对象的模板。类是静态的,它们的内容在程序执行前已经定义好,而对象是动态的,它们在程序执行时可以被创建和删除。 2、面向对象:即面向事物。面向对象是对现实世界事务的理解与抽象。 3、面向对象的好处------封装、继承、多态、抽象。...

2019-04-03 13:59:11 118

转载 Maven建立的父工程用处

1、统一管理jar包的版本,其依赖需要在子工程中定义才有效2、统一的依赖管理3、控制插件的版本4、聚合工程

2019-03-07 16:23:17 2531

原创 java的重写与重载

重写: 1、定义:重写是子类对父类的允许访问的方法的实现过程(方法体)进行重新编写 2、要求: 两同两小一大 方法名相同,参数列表相同 子类返回类型小于等于父类方法返回类型 子类抛出异常小于等于父类方法抛出异常 子类访问权限大于等于父类方法访问权限...

2018-11-30 21:15:45 132

转载 反射机制

反射机制——程序在运行时能够获取自身的信息(获取属性和方法)静态编译:在编译时确定类型,绑定对象,即通过。动态编译:运行时确定类型,绑定对象。动态编译最大限度发挥了java的灵活性,体现了多态的应用,有以降低类之间的藕合性反射机制的优点就是可以实现动态创建对象和编译,体现出很大的灵活性...

2018-11-13 20:15:37 73

原创 ERROR 1366 (HY000): Incorrect string value: '\xCA\xD6\xBB\xFA\xCA\xFD...' for column 'cname' at row

向表中插入中文报错ERROR 1366 (HY000): Incorrect string value: '\xCA\xD6\xBB\xFA\xCA\xFD...' for column 'cname' at row 11、查看编码方式(在安装mysql数据库时若是选择编码方式为utf8为默认的编码格式,结果如下:) show variables like 'character%';...

2018-10-23 14:39:18 5307

原创 .NET平台下XmlDocument与XDocument写入xml

1、用xmlDOcuemnt把List集合中的内容循环写入到xml中 List<Person> mylist=new List<Person>(); mylist.Add(new Person() { name = "李大", age = 20, email = "lida@163.xom" }); myli...

2018-04-29 17:28:19 497

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除